Dr Hyung Jin Chang is an Associate Professor in the School of Computer Science at the University of Birmingham. He earned a PhD in machine learning and computer vision from Seoul National University in 2013, following a BSc in Electrical and Computer Engineering from the same institution in 2006.
- Research focuses on artificial intelligence, computer vision, robotics, and human-robot interaction, particularly human-centred visual learning for hand/body pose estimation, gaze tracking, and action/internal state understanding.
- Key projects include EU FP7 GRANT 612139, EU H2020 GRANT 643783, and industry collaborations with Samsung Electronics and Samsung GRO Grant.
- Recent publications address advancements in unsupervised learning, domain adaptation, 3D hand-object interaction modeling, and multimodal gaze following in conversational scenarios.
His work bridges theoretical AI research with practical applications in vision-based robotics and medical image analysis, supported by both academic and industrial grants.
